Licensed Therapist (Full-Time)

Full-time opportunity for a licensed clinician who is passionate about supporting individuals and couples in a warm, collaborative, and growth-oriented practice.

Location: Berkley, MI
Employment Type: Full-Time, W-2
Compensation: $65,000 - $80,000
Caseload Expectation: 25 client sessions per week
Administrative Time: Additional 5 hours per week
Reports To: Clinical Supervisor

Position Overview

Peace Of Mind Therapy is seeking a full-time Licensed Therapist to join our Berkley practice. This role is ideal for a clinician who is passionate about working with both individuals and couples and is excited to continue developing clinical skills, especially in couples and relationship work.

We’re looking for someone who brings warmth, curiosity, professionalism, and clinical integrity to their work while valuing collaboration, connection, and ongoing professional growth.

What You’ll Do

  • Provide high-quality, ethical counseling services in person and through telehealth
  • Work with individuals and couples to support emotional wellbeing and relationship growth
  • Maintain timely and accurate clinical documentation, including intake assessments, progress notes, treatment plans, and related records
  • Collaborate with care teams when clinically appropriate
  • Respond to client communication within 24 hours
  • Participate in supervision, team meetings, and ongoing training
  • Maintain a consistent weekly caseload and schedule
  • Uphold the mission, values, and clinical standards of Peace Of Mind Therapy

Qualifications

  • Master’s or Doctoral degree in Social Work, Counseling, or a related field
  • Active, unrestricted Michigan license such as LMSW, LCSW, LMFT, LCPC, PhD, PsyD, LLP, or LP
  • Minimum of 2 years of post-licensure clinical experience
  • Strong documentation, organization, and communication skills
  • Ability to maintain a caseload of 25 sessions per week
  • Private practice experience preferred

Preferred Experience

  • Strong interest in couples and relationship work
  • Training in CBT, DBT, ACT, EMDR, EFT, Psychodynamic Therapy, or similar modalities
  • Trauma-informed care experience
  • Interest in somatic approaches and nervous system-informed care
  • A defined clinical specialty such as trauma, anxiety, grief, or anger management
  • BCBS paneling is a plus

Benefits & Growth

  • PTO
  • 401(k) match
  • License reimbursement
  • Training and growth opportunities

Schedule Expectations

  • Availability for at least two evenings per week, or one evening plus one weekend block of approximately 6 hours
  • Evening hours may extend until 8:00 PM
